A WORD FROM THE PUBLISHER

One sided reporting?


This week we received a call from a member of Franklin Mews LLC, the group that bought the piece of open space at Franklin Court from the Village in 2014. The person said that in our reporting we had not told the side of the story of the LLC, which is that the group’s goals were to preserve the property as open space.

If we have failed to present all sides of the issue, we do apologize to the members of the LLC. Unfortunately the list of members has not been publicly available and is not subject to the Freedom of Information Law.

However, if any members would like to be interviewed so that we can present all sides of the matter we would be happy to sit down with them. (And as always, our letters column and online comments are available as well.)

Now that the matter has presumably been concluded, if not to everyone’s satisfaction, at least in a way that is tolerable to all, there should be no impediment to keep members of the LLC from presenting their side of the story, and we would like to help bring closure to the issue.
